Fenoverine occupies a distinct clinical niche as an antispasmodic pharmaceutical indicated for relief of abdominal pain and irritable bowel syndrome manifestations. Clinicians and formulary decision-makers value the compound for its targeted smooth muscle relaxation properties, tolerability profile, and suitability across multiple delivery formats. As healthcare delivery models evolve and patient expectations shift toward more convenient and personalized therapeutic regimens, fenoverine's positioning must be viewed through both clinical and commercial lenses.

Detailed segmentation provides the analytical foundation to align product development and commercial tactics with clinical use cases and channel behavior. Based on formulation, the market divides between injectable and oral formats. Injectable options comprise solutions and suspensions that are typically prioritized for acute-care settings and clinician-administered interventions, while oral formats encompass capsules, solutions, and tablets. Tablets warrant additional attention because they are available as immediate-release and modified-release variants, enabling differentiated dosing profiles and adherence strategies.
Regarding clinical application, fenoverine is principally positioned for abdominal pain and irritable bowel syndrome, with each indication bringing distinct prescribing considerations. Patients with acute abdominal pain in clinical settings may favor parenteral administration for rapid symptom control, whereas chronic functional disorders such as irritable bowel syndrome tend to favor oral chronic-use formats that emphasize tolerability and convenience. Consequently, aligning formulation investments with indication-driven demand profiles will optimize clinical uptake and patient satisfaction.
Distribution dynamics also matter. Supply moves through hospital pharmacy, online pharmacy, and retail pharmacy channels, with online options further segmented into direct-to-patient fulfillment and third-party e-commerce platforms. Each distribution pathway entails different logistical, regulatory, and patient-engagement requirements; hospital pharmacies demand robust supply reliability and institutional contracting, retail pharmacies focus on over-the-counter accessibility and pharmacist engagement, and online channels emphasize patient convenience and digital support tools. End-user distinctions among clinics, home care, and hospitals emphasize where clinical touchpoints occur and thus where educational and support resources must be concentrated.
Dosage strength segmentation across 100 mg, 150 mg, and 200 mg strengths affects formularies and prescribing patterns by providing flexibility for titration and individualized dosing. Route-of-administration segmentation between oral and parenteral reinforces the strategic tension between chronic outpatient management and acute inpatient therapy.
